Continuing our tour, we arrive at Trinity College, Ireland's oldest university, founded in 1592. Known for its stunning architecture and picturesque green spaces, Trinity College is home to the Book of Kells, an exquisite illuminated manuscript dating back to the 9th century. Visitors can also explore the Long Room Library, housing over 200,000 ancient books. The college grounds invite you to bask in their beauty, offering a peaceful escape from the city's hustle, making it worthwhile to wander freely through the gardens.
